WebFeb 3, 2013 · Low cholesterol is associated with mental health disorders, such as depression, anxiety, suicidal tendencies, impulsivity, and aggressive behavior ( Partonen, Haukka et al. 1999 ). Importantly, as it relates to this blog, some researchers suspect that abnormal cholesterol and sterol metabolism may also contribute to the development of … WebAutism spectrum disorder (ASD) has been associated with low cholesterol levels in a limited number of studies. WebAbstract. Cholesterol is essential for embryological development, cellular membrane structure and function, and synthesis of hormones, bile acids, vitamin D and neuroactive steroids.
